Dr. Pilcher is the Frank P. Smith Professor and Chair of the Department of Neurological Surgery. A fellowship-trained neurosurgeon who specializes in epilepsy surgery, Dr. Pilcher joined the Medical Center faculty in 1991. In addition to his general neurosurgical practice, he is affiliated with the Strong Epilepsy Center.
Dr. Pilcher received his medical and doctoral degrees from the University of Rochester School of Medicine and Dentistry and completed his neurosurgical residency at Strong Memorial Hospital. He completed fellowship training in neurosurgery and epilepsy surgery at the University of Washington, Seattle. |
